Box Office: Martial Arts Beat Marshall, Sarah

The Forbidden Kingdom, a family-friendly martial-arts pic that marked the first-ever on-screen duel between Jet Li and Jackie Chan, topped the weekend box office with a $20.9 million opening. Placing second was Forgetting Sarah Marshall ($17.3 mil), starring Jason Segel, Mila Kunis and Kristen Bell.

Rounding out the weekend's top five were Prom Night ($9.1 mil), Al Pacino's critically lambasted 88 Minutes ($6.8 mil) and Nim's Island ($5.7 mil).

All told, the numbers marked the first time in over a month that receipts were up year-over-year. That said, movie attendance is still pacing 6.5 percent behind 2007. Hurry, Indiana Jones!
